Why Mobile Optimization Matters
Many consumers use smartphones and tablets to browse online stores. If your Etsy shop isn’t optimized for mobile, visitors may encounter slow loading times, difficult navigation, or unreadable text. These issues can lead to higher bounce rates and lost sales.
Key Strategies for Mobile Optimization
1. Simplify Your Shop Layout
Use a clean and straightforward shop layout. Avoid clutter and ensure important elements like product images, titles, and prices are prominently displayed. Clear navigation menus help users find what they need quickly.
2. Optimize Product Images
Use high-quality images that are appropriately sized for mobile screens. Compress images to reduce load times without sacrificing quality. Include multiple angles to give customers a comprehensive view of your products.
3. Improve Loading Speed
Fast-loading pages are crucial for mobile users. Minimize the use of heavy scripts and unnecessary plugins. Use tools like Google PageSpeed Insights to identify and fix speed issues.
Additional Tips for Mobile Success
- Use Mobile-Responsive Themes: Choose themes that automatically adapt to different screen sizes.
- Streamline Checkout: Simplify the checkout process to reduce cart abandonment.
- Test Regularly: Use mobile devices to test your shop’s usability and make improvements based on feedback.
